ELIZAVETA BUGRIMENKO, cello

Elizaveta (Lisa) began her music study at 5.  In nearly all categories of the questionnaire she run out of space listing her nominees, be they her favorite composers (from Schubert and Brahms to Prokofiev and Bartok), living performers (Gutman, Afanasiev, Bylsma, Tretiakov) or those departed (Cassals, Richter, DuPre).  Quite understandable, coming from a person who already in her early childhood had aspiration as diverse as becoming a ballerina, a Bach, a pianist or a nurse.

Lisa enjoys folk music from different parts of the world and is an accomplished dancer.  After saying "If there were more time..." she lists drawing, singing, ending with "etc." at the end of the last line.  She would be happy to return for her next life in any of the capacities for which she does not have time now, but stresses, that this should be "on this earth".
